Title: DHCPv6 Relay Agent Information Option

This document introduces the capabilities of the DHCPv4 Relay Agent
Information Option in RFC 3046 and the corresponding RADIUS- Attributes
Sub-option to DHCPv6. In particular, the document describes a new DHCPv6
option called the Relay Agent Information option which extends the set of
DHCPv6 options as defined in RFC 3315 and 3376. Following its DHCPv4
counterpart as defined in RFC 3046, the new option is inserted by the
DHCPv6 relay agent when forwarding client-originated DHCPv6 packets to a
DHCPv6 server. Servers recognizing the Relay Agent Information option may
use the information to implement IP address or other parameter assignment
policies. The DHCP Server echoes the option back verbatim to the relay
agent in server-to-client replies, and the relay agent strips the option
before forwarding the reply to the client. The Relay Agent Information
option is organized as a single DHCPv6 option that contains one or more
Attributes Sub-option, following its DHCPv4 counterpart, is also defined.
